Here's what the website says on mine:
M Sport Package Sport Suspension delete Dynamic Damper Control High-gloss Roof Rails Roof rails in Aluminum Satin Performance Control Sport seats Aerodynamic kit Anthracite headliner Shadowline exterior trim I really have no idea why they delete the sport suspension like that and wondered why they did that myself. I wouldn't worry too much about what the website says. You will get the sport suspension, they didn't really delete it. And I remember now being confused about the roof rails too because mine says the high gloss and aluminum satin. As far as my eyes can tell, my car came with aluminum satin roof rails. I'm not sure if there would be a difference in the 28i and 35i, as I have the 28i. If you don't have it already, ask your CA for a "Vehicle Inquiry." I'm not sure if there is a better name for it, but it shows your exactly what was ordered and that is exactly how it will be delivered, regardless of what the website says. I know it's hard to not believe what the website says.

Thanks, we are having a great trip. PCD was a lot of fun. My wife wasn't feeling too well so she sat out some of the driving stuff. The hot lap was WILD! I really enjoyed the off-road course. It is short but shows what the X3 can do. I hope we never get in a situation with 2 wheels in the air, but the X3 can handle it. The factory tour was fun, but I'm an engineer so I'm a little biased. Throughout the X3 assembly line I only spotted one Blue Water so my wife's will be pretty rare I think. It was interesting to see left hand and right hand drives intermixed on the line. The robotics are pretty cool but a fair amount is still done by hand. They do a lot to reduce boredom and repetative use problems, such as rotating through 4 jobs each shift.
I'm already thinking about when I get to replace my vehicle with a BMW, after owning one for 2 days. There was a Vermillion Red ready for delivery that looked nice, I think M Sport. My wife got this one and I got her old Explorer, which I figure I will keep 4 more years. Maybe less now that I have the bug!
